Inkitt Contests
Has anyone else tried their hand at one of the Inkitt writing contests? These require 20,000 words or more and revolve around a general theme. This month the theme is Myth or Legend, next month is open to any genre and any topic! I have found this to be a great way to get instant reader feedback. There is a really nice mix of readers and writers on the platform too. I write something new for the contests and not something I am very attached too, but it has been a nice way to test out new ideas and to see what readers are looking for in a story. I would highly recommend for anyone just wanting to test something out - even if it's not for one of their contests.
